Официальное название
Protocol for Comparing Closed-loop syncHronization vErsuS convenTional Synchronization In sPontaneously Breathing Pediatric Patients (CHESTSIPP) - a Randomized Cross-over Study
Обзор
A prior research indicated that asynchrony between the patient and ventilator occurred in 33 percent of 19,175 breaths, and was seen in every patient. The most prevalent kind of asynchrony was ineffective triggering (68%), followed by delayed termination (19%), double triggering (4%) and premature termination (3%). Asynchrony between the patient and ventilator increased considerably with decreasing levels of peak inspiratory pressure, positive end-expiratory pressure, and set frequency.Despite this, more asynchrony categories exist, and there is no widely accepted categorization. Major asynchronies, however, include auto trigger, ineffective effort, and double trigger, while minor asynchronies include early/late cycle, trigger delay, and spontaneous breaths during a mandatory breath. This study aims to compare the safety and efficacy of a closed-loop synchronization controller with conventional control of synchronization during invasive mechanical ventilation of spontaneous breathing of pediatric patients in a pediatric intensive care unit (PICU).
Вмешательства
- Устройство close-loop synchronization controller with SPONT mode
One-hour period where the pressure support of spontaneous breath will be automatically titrated based on pressure and flow waveform analysis obtained from the patient. - Устройство Conventional synchronization settings with SPONT mode
One-hour period where the pressure support of spontaneous breath will be manually set.
Первичные конечные точки
- Asynchrony Index [Срок оценки: 1 hour]
Вторичные конечные точки (6)
- Major asynchronies [Срок оценки: 1 hour]
- Minor asynchronies [Срок оценки: 1 hour]
- Comfort Behavioral Score [Срок оценки: 1 hour]
- Leak [Срок оценки: 1 hour]
- Mean SpO2 [Срок оценки: 1 hour]
- Mean EtCO2 [Срок оценки: 1 hour]
Критерии участия
Критерии включения
- Pediatric patients older than 1 month and younger than18 years of age
- Hospitalized at the PICU with the intention of treatment with mechanical ventilation at least for the upcoming 3 hours with spontaneous breathing activity
- Written informed consent signed and dated by the patient or one relative in case that the patient is unable to consent, after full explanation of the study by the investigator and prior to study participation
Критерии исключения
- Formalized ethical decision to withhold or withdraw life support
- Patient included in another interventional research study under consent
- Patient already enrolled in the present study in a previous episode of respiratory failure
- Pregnant woman
- Patients deemed at high risk for the need of transportation from PICU to another ward, diagnostic unit or any other hospital
- Hemodynamic instability defined as a need of continuous infusion of epinephrine or norepinephrine > 1 mg/h
- Not being able to obtain reference waveform
